They're more expensive Over-ear headphones are also referred to as circumaural headphones. They are worn on the ear, creating a seal to block out external sounds. They tend to be larger and heavier than on-ear headphones, however they also offer the highest quality audio and comfort. Some over-ear headphones are even noise-canceling, making them a popular choice for commuters as well as business travelers. Over-ear headphones usually have larger drivers than on-ear headphones, which allows them to reproduce lower frequencies with greater clarity and precision. This is particularly advantageous for those who listen to genres of music that depend on bass, like electronic or hip-hop. Additionally, over-ear headphones can provide a larger spatial and soundstage that make the listener feel as if they are in the concert hall or recording studio. The price of bose over head headphones ear headphones can differ based on the features and technology that are built into the headphone. The most affordable models can be purchased at as low as 50$, and are ideal for music lovers who are casual. Over ear headphones that are mid-range in price are available for around 100$. They offer more comfort in terms of sound quality, durability and comfort than the entry-level models. The most expensive over ear headphones are specifically designed for audiophiles and come with advanced technology like adaptive noise cancelation and hi-res DAC.
